Interning at SOHA Engineers

The organization I was lucky, enough to intern for is named SOHA Engineers. Interning at SOHA is an opportunity I am beyond grateful to participate in.  Working at SOHA was always a learning experience and management always allowed me to be involved in projects no matter how big the project was to the firm. What SOHA does is complete structural designs, seismic rehabilitation, historic renovation, seismic evaluation, peer review, plan checking, Shoring and Underpinning, and construction support. Its clear SOHA completes any project required, there isn't any project to big or to small for SOHA Engineers. SOHA employees are professionals who all have completed degree's in they're respected fields and have very much earned the right to represent SOHA. Being that I was around such qualified individuals, my role was mainly to assist with projects in anyway possible I was needed. I would sometime complete paperwork for projects and also go out to sites with Art Dell and work as his assistant. Overall, I would report to Art Dell and complete many projects he had prepared for me to complete.
